PURPOSE:to improve the reaction and selectivity to aldehydes in the hydroformylation of olefins, by using a specific weakly-basic anion-exchange resin which is easily available and reusable and a Co catalyst. CONSTITUTION:Aldehydes or alcohols are obtained by reacting olefins with CO and H2 in the presence of a Co catalyst and a weakly-basic anion-exchange resin at 50-200 deg.C and at 50-1000 atm. A resin, preferably non-heterocyclic amine which is insoluble in both the raw material and reaction product, type (e.g. polyamine or tertiary amine type having a styrene - divinylbenzene copolymer skeleton), is used as the exchange resin in an amount less than an equivalent, preferably 0.1-0.5 equivalent, of the effective ion-exchange group per g atom of Co of the catalyst. |
